Effective use of Social Media for enterprises is becoming more and more impressive. A lot of enterprises are either evaluating or debating on how to effectively use social media for business benefits.

Being part of the healthcare IT space, I wanted to analyze the benefits of using social media in the healthcare sector. Here is a small list which I came up with and I would appreciate if it can be extended by the readers through experience and innovation.

Enterprise Twitter

Twitter has already taken the world by swing and enterprise twitter for healthcare is a very useful application in my opinion. Typically physicians and other healthcare professionals are always under strict timelines. Updating useful information on the move is a wonderful idea.

For e.g. If there is a patient visit re-scheduled the reception can alert the physician through a tweet immediately.

If there is an emergency and a set of individuals are to be intimated, twittering the message makes it a convenient option.

General awareness campaigns whenever required can be carried out easily through an enterprise twitter kind of platform.

Social Presence for Brand Building

Like every other enterprise, brand building is an important aspect in Healthcare as well. Having social presence will significantly improve brand building exercise for the institution. Institutions can market new services and solutions during social interactions. Focused awareness campaigns and informational sessions would further strengthen institutions brand.

Enterprise Social Network Platform

While external social network platform act as catalysts to improve brand building, healthcare institutions can significantly increase their patient relationship management and collaborations with different stake holders within and surrounding the healthcare set-up by maintaining their own enterprise social network set-up.

SaaS based PHR

With preventive care becoming more and more important with the patients, sharing personal health record information is becoming increasingly critical. The next generation Software as a service model can be leveraged to share patients personal health record information through secure web based interfaces.

Test Reporting over Mobile or Collaborative Platforms

Next generation mobile and collaborative platforms can be leveraged to transfer various medical reports to the patients. While patient physical presence might be required for some of the medical reports, there are a lot of such reports, whose information can be transmitted to the patient over mobile. Information transmission becomes easier and faster and at the same time it is convenient for both the healthcare institutions and patients.
